When is the best time of year to stay in a hostel in Gananoque?
The weather is important when you want to venture out and explore, so here’s a little information about the local climate: The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 66°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 26°F. The snowiest months in Gananoque are January, February, March, and November, with each month seeing an average of 18 inches of snowfall.
What is there to see and do in Gananoque?
Depending on how you want to spend your time, you might appreciate some places near Gananoque. Get out into nature with places like Lake Ontario, Confederation Park, and Sculpture Park. Cultural attractions include Thousand Islands Playhouse, Springer Theatre, and Arthur Child Heritage Museum. Visit landmarks like Rock Island Lighthouse State Park, Boldt Yacht House, and Kingston Mills.
What's the best way to get to and around Gananoque while staying at a hostel?
Keep this information about transit options in and around Gananoque in your back pocket to make the most of your stay: You can fly into the closest airport, which is Kingston, ON (YGK-Norman Rogers), 22.9 mi (36.8 km) away from the city center. Another option is Watertown, NY (ART-Watertown Intl.), located 24.2 mi (38.9 km) away.
